Abstract
This paper deals with a piezoelectric ceramic multi-morph actuator. Included in the first part is investigation of its force factor and electro-mechanical coupling factor in static operation. The force factor can be made large in proportion to the layer number of piezoelectric ceramics. Therefore the multi-morph actuator can yield relatively large displacement in spite of low input voltage. But its electro-mechanical coupling factor is improved little. Second part contains new displacement devices as an application of the actuator; cantilever displacement device with zero slope at its head, integrated displacement and turned back displacement devices are reported.
